The Jozani Forest tour is unique for its endemic Zanzibar red colobus monkeys, found nowhere else on Earth. These rare, endangered primates are unafraid of humans, allowing close encounters.
The forest also features a mangrove boardwalk, offering an immersive journey through a vital ecosystem that protects coastlines and nurtures marine life.
Beyond wildlife, Jozani blends tropical rainforests, saltwater marshes, and cultural history, including its role as a refuge for escaped slaves.
The tour promotes sustainable tourism, supporting conservation and local communities. Its accessibility, rich biodiversity, and serene atmosphere make it a one-of-a-kind experience, combining adventure, education, and eco-conscious travel in Zanzibar’s natural heart.

Kalatuka Museum tours and Arican Shrine
The building which is now a museum was Fela's home and is now open as a museum for travelers to explore. A number of personal artifacts and household items are on display. At the Kalakuta Museum,you will also have access to purchase branded souvenirs and access his private closet. From Kalakuta Republic Museum, you will head straight to the New Afrika Shrine, a popular spot for culture, Afro music, good foods and drinks. The shrine is owned and managed by Fela's children,Femi Kuti and Yeni Kuti.

Abuja Cuisine Tour
Nigeria is home to many communities with diverse cuisines. While some are popular for heavy meals, those in Abuja are known for finger foods, snacks, and delicious natural drinks.
Do you want to find out what kilishi tastes like? Everyone simply loves this delicacy. A trip to Abuja isn’t complete without a taste of kilishi, and a wrap for folks back home. Suya is another thing you simply have to try. Whether its ram Suya, beef suya, or chicken suya, the taste is always irresistible. You’ll visit a popular spot, Yahuza Suya, and Kilishi Limited. It’s the home of Suya and Kilishi.
To go with the Kilishi and Suya, you'll have a refreshing Zobo drink. It is made from dried rosella leaves (Hibiscus Sabdariffa). A bit of ginger and pineapple are usually added as well.
Fura de Nunu is another fun drink. Made from fermented cow milk and ground millet grains, it is rich in nutrients and soft on the palates. Join this trip and pamper your palates with the creamy taste of Fura de Nunu.
Ibadan Cultural and Historical Tour
Ibadan, in south-western Nigeria, has a rich cultural heritage and a fascinating history.
Bower’s Tower was built in memory of Captain Lister Bower, the first British national to live in and explore Ibadan. Will you like to catch a glimpse of the popular Ibadan red roofs? Then you’ll have to take the spiral stairs to the top of this 18-meter (60 feet) high building.
Do you want to explore the history and culture of Nigeria? The National Museum, Ibadan, will give you all you seek. The museum is classified into four distinct sections: Unity Gallery, Yoruba Gallery, Masquerade Gallery, and Pottery Gallery.
Mapo Hall is the colonial-style Ibadan city hall. It was built in 1929 and has a mini-museum where you’ll see relics of the colonial era and pictures of the city’s previous rulers.
At the Topfat art gallery, you’ll find beautiful contemporary artworks of Nigerian and West African artists. It’s a good place to purchase souvenirs and gift items.

Learn about the Yoruba faith, a religion that is among the world's ten largest. Traditional Yoruba religious beliefs recognize a wide variety of deities, with Olodumare known as the creator and other spirits serving as intermediates to help with the concerns of humans. The deities include "Ọya" (wind goddess), "Ifa" (divination or fate), "Ẹlẹda" (destiny), "Ọsanyin" (medicines and healing),"Ọsun" (goddess of fertility, protector of children and mothers), and Ṣango (God of thunder),among others.
Yoruba religion and mythology is a major influence in West Africa chiefly in Nigeria, and has given origin to several New World religions such as Santería in Cuba, Puerto Rico and Candomblé in Brazil.
